ESPN Senior NBA insider Adrian 'Woj' Wojnarowski delivered the update via Twitter on Tuesday afternoon. 'In aftermath of Kyrie Irving trade, the Brooklyn Nets and Kevin Durant are having ongoing conversations on the direction of the franchise,' the tweet read. 'But organization has thus far told inquiring teams that they're not planning to trade him before Thursday's deadline, souces tell ESPN.' Wojnarowski then revealed a number of suitors have been on alert regarding the two-time NBA champion's availability. 'Durant had interest in a deal to the Suns over the summer, but so far the Nets haven't shown a wilingness to move him to Phoenix or anywhere else, sources tell ESPN. There have been a number of teams reaching out to Brooklyn on Durant.'
